Cost of Attendance (COA)

For academic year 2022-2023, the tuition & fees is $22,152 at Industrial Management Training Institute. 52 % students out of total 20 undergraduate students received financial aid(grants or scholarship) and the average amount of the aid is $9,033.
The living costs including room, board, and other expenses are $45,001 when a student lives off campus at Industrial Management Training Institute. The total cost of attendance (COA) is $69,103 before receiving financial aid and the net price with financial aid is $60,070.

Industrial Management Training Institute 2023 Tuition & Fees

For academic year 2022-2023, the tuition & fees of Industrial Management Training Institute are $22,152 for Electrician program which is the largest career program at Industrial Management Training Institute. The tuition & fees are increased by 10.02% compared to previous academic year.

Industrial Management Training Institute 2023 Largest Program Tuition & Fees

The largest program at Industrial Management Training Institute is Electrician and its tuition & fees is $22,152 and the books & supplies cost is $1,950. The total length of the program 19 weeks as completed (full-time attending status) and the average number of months to complete the program is 19 months. The next table shows the average tuition & fees for 3 largest programs at Industrial Management Training Institute.
2022-2023 Largest Program Tuition & fees at Industrial Management Training Institute
Tuition & FeesBooks & Supplies Costs
Electrician$22,152$1,950
Heating, Air Conditioning, Ventilation and Refrigeration Maintenance Technology$23,088$1,840
Plumbing Technology/Plumber$23,328$1,990
